The Academy Award® winning Maya® 3D animation and effects software is the first choice of film and video artists, game developers, and 3D design professionals. Discover how to build, render, and animate your own digital models and scenes, and begin to develop professional-level Maya skills with the latest edition of this popular bestseller.

Starting with the basics, the book builds from the ground up, combining straightforward text with practical examples that make it fun and easy to learn Maya's core features while introducing new Maya 8 elements such as improved polygon tools and enhanced rendering with mental ray. Clear-cut, engaging lessons let you experiment using the wealth of files provided on the CD-ROM. You'll also find an abundance of instructional and inspirational Maya creations in the full-color insert.

The accompanying CD-ROMs images, movies, and scene files let you view material from the book right on your own computer. Tackle all-new rendering and dynamics tutorials and much more. The CD includes Maya Personal Learning Edition software.

Summary: Did anyone edit this book?
Comment: There are several sections in this book that were clearly not revised for version 8.0 of Maya. This includes both visual examples and the writing. Turn to page 252: "You can select the specific attribute and zoom in on its curve to see it better, or now with Maya 7, you can normalize the. . ." Inexcusable.

Additionally, it would really help if some of the instructional examples were in color, particularly those showing wireframe models. It's difficult to tell what's going on when what would normally be highlighted on the wireframe is grey like the rest of the model.

Otherwise, the author writes pretty well. I appreciated the sense of humor, too.

Summary: Not the best Maya book, and here's why..
Comment: This isn't a great beginner's book. If you want a better beginner's book, get the Maya foundation book. It costs more, but it's worth it.
Here's why this book doesn't work for a beginner. First it gives you way too many pages of overview at the beginning. Not that it's bad stuff, but you don't want (or need) to read for two or three hours when you are ready to start using the program. If you do get this book here is my honest recommendation of how to go about using this book. Start on Chapter 2 and read all about the basic tools. But then on page 53 when you get to the heading "Outliner/Hypergraph", skip directly to Chapter 4. Eventually you will want to come back and read the rest of Chapter 2, but reading about the node structure and all the editor systems for a beginner is dumb. It's good stuff mind you, but not what you want or need yet, so don't forget about it. Notice that I said skip to chapter 4. Personally I wouldn't read chapter 3 at all. Why start animating when you don't even know how to model yet? This book isn't bad, it's just poorly organized. If you follow the directions listed above, I think you'll feel much more satisfied not only with this book, but with Maya in general.
